본문 바로가기

전체 글107

[Git] Stage & Commit 작업의 영역을 3분할한다. 1. 작업 트리(working tree) : 우리가 눈으로 보고 작업하는 영역 2. 스테이지(staging area) : 버전으로 만들 파일이 대기하는 곳. 작업트리의 작업물 중 버전으로 만들 작업물을 staging area로 넘겨 준다. 3. 저장소(repository) : staging area에서 대기하고 있는 파일들을 버전으로 만들어 저장하는 장소. staging area, repository 두 영역을 .git 디렉토리에서 관장한다. working tree에서 작업한 것을 add 하면 staging area로, staging area에 대기 중인 파일을 commit 하면 version이 된다. git status 명령어를 입력했을 때, 아직 한 번도 버전 관리하지 않은.. 2023. 1. 2.
[Git] Git init Git init : 깃을 사용할 수 있도록 디렉토리를 초기화하는 명령어. 위와 같은 창이 뜬다면 해당 디렉터리에서 git을 사용 가능하다. 숨김 폴더로 .git이라는 디렉터리가 생기는데, 이 디렉터리가 앞으로 버전을 저장할 repository이다. 2023. 1. 2.
[Git] 기본 Linux 명령어 pwd > 현 위치 경로 ls > 현 디렉토리의 파일, 디렉토리 확인 * ls 명령 옵션 -a 숨김파일 + 디렉터리 함께 표시 -l 상세 정보 표기 -r 정렬 순서 거꾸로 -t 작성 시간 내림차순 표시 cd/cd .. > pass 단, cd~ > 홈 디렉터리로 이동 인 것만 알아둘 것 ~ 현재 접속 중인 사용자의 홈 디렉터리. 홈 디렉터리 : C/Users/사용자 아이디 ./ 현재 사용자가 작업 중인 디렉터리 ../ 현재 디렉터리의 상위 디렉터리 mkdir > 디렉토리 만들기 rm > 디렉토리 삭제 * rm -r > 디렉토리 내의 하위 디렉토리와 파일까지 삭제 2023. 1. 2.
[Unity] Start vs Awake Awake: 스크립트가 연결된 객체가 인스턴스화되거나, 스크립트가 처음 로드될 때 호출 단, 모든 객체의 Awake함수는 무작위로 호출된다. Start: 컴포넌트가 활성화될 때 Awake - Start - Update 순서로 호출됨. 즉, Awake가 Start보다 빠르다. Start에 넣은 구문이 실행이 안 되어서 Awake에 넣었더니 실행되었다. 궁금해서 조금 찾아보았다. 2023. 1. 2.